Nutrition Facts

One Serving size: 1 oz(s) - 29 g

Nutrition per serving DV
Protein 4g 8%
Calories 190 cal 11%
Calories from Fat 140 cal 21%
Total Fat 15g 24%
Saturated Fat (bad) 4g 24%
Total Carbohydrate 9g 4%
Sodium (good) 0g 0%
Cholesterol (good) 0g 0%
Dietary Fiber (good) 4g 16%
Sugars (good) 1g 2%
Added Sugars (good) 0g 0%
Vitamin A 0IU 0%
Vitamin C 0.0012g 2%
Iron 0.00108g 6%
Calcium 0g 0%
